Description
One of the great potential benefits of RasterIndex is handling complex transformations where the pixel plane is not aligned with the world plane. A RasterIndex instance can indeed manage the coordinates of the two axes both represented as 2-dimensional lazy arrays.
This is explained more in detail here: https://discourse.pangeo.io/t/example-which-highlights-the-limitations-of-netcdf-style-coordinates-for-large-geospatial-rasters/4140/12, with possible examples including low-level data products (raw acquisition image data with arbitrary GCPs) but also intentional transformations (e.g., rotation) for specific data processing purpose.
